Frequently asked questions

Is Hopewell Holdings a single family office or an operating conglomerate?

Hopewell operates as a hybrid — a single-family-controlled holding company that directly owns and manages operating businesses in infrastructure, property, and hospitality, rather than functioning as a passive investment allocator. The Wu family consolidated full control through a take-private transaction completed in 2019.

Who currently leads investment and operational decisions at Hopewell?

Thomas Wu, the son of founder Sir Gordon Wu, assumed leadership of the firm during its transition to a private entity. The exact investment committee structure post-privatization is not publicly documented.

What is Hopewell's primary investment focus?

The firm concentrates on direct, control-oriented investments in physical assets across Hong Kong and mainland China. Its core sectors are toll-road infrastructure, commercial and residential property development, and hospitality operations.

Does Hopewell invest in third-party funds or venture capital?

There is no public evidence that Hopewell allocates to external fund managers, venture funds, or startup equity. The firm's historical and current posture is direct, majority-stake ownership and operation of large-scale hard assets.

How did Hopewell transition from public to private ownership?

In 2019, a consortium led by the founding Wu family delisted Hopewell Holdings through a HK$21 billion take-private offer, ending its nearly five-decade run on the Hong Kong Stock Exchange. The move allowed the family to manage the portfolio without public-market scrutiny.
